Find the missing values.
| Base | Height | Area |
| 17 mm | 221 sq.mm |
Advertisements
उत्तर
Given: Height h = 17 mm
Area of the parallelogram = 221 sq.mm
b × h = 221
b × 17 = 221
b = `221/17`
b = 13 m
Tabulating the results, we get
| Base | Height | Area |
| 13 m | 17 mm | 221 sq.mm |
